Functional Responsibilities

This is a local position, it is therefore open to Nationals of Ukraine and to individuals who have a valid residence/work permit.
Summary of the functions:
  1. ICT client services, management and administration

  2. Network administration

  3. Team Management 

  4. Knowledge building and knowledge sharing 

1. ICT client services, management and administration
  • Ensures efficient and effective ICT client services, management and administration, focusing on achievement of the following results:

  • Implementation of ICT and operational strategies compliant with UNOPS rules, regulations, policies and framework.

  • Information technology and systems planning exercises undertaken in the Business Unit, and representing the Business Unit in those undertaken throughout UNOPS.

  • Provision of fast, friendly, and effective user support 

  • Participation in the development of ICT standards and strategies.

  • Maintenance of inventory of all computer, telecommunication equipment, I/O devices and software existent in the Business Unit ensuring compliance with registration and upgrades.

  • Interaction with HQ and ICT personnel from other UN agencies in the area to share and exchange information and expertise on applications and tools. 

  • Effective functioning (installation, operation and maintenance) of all UNOPS hardware equipment and acquisition of hardware supplies.

  • Supervision of information and communication services of the Business Unit and managed projects

  • Effective advice on all project implementation activities involving ICT; the hardware and software procurement process; and establishment and maintenance of a roster of potential suppliers.

  • Active networking with clients, addressing and improving common areas of concern.

  • Provision of consulting services, ICT audit inspections and/or facilitation of selection/deployment of software to projects, seeking technical advice and support from HQ ICT personnel, as required.

  • Liaison with UNOPS Headquarters, and other relevant units, to determine hardware and software requirements.

  • UNOPS' liaison with the local UN partner agencies on issues relating to UNOPS ICT.                                      

2. Network administration
  • Ensure efficient network administration, focusing on achievement of the following results:

  • Maintenance of network and internet connectivity to ensure stable operation, availability of bandwidth, and reliable connection to the internet and HQ based systems.

  • Valid hardware maintenance agreements, to ensure timely resolution of hardware failures.

  • A stable and responsive network environment based on daily monitoring of the network connection.

  • Ensure confidentiality, integrity and availability of UNOPS ICT systems and UNOPS information assets.

  • Monitor and maintain proper backups of UNOPS data. Maintenance of measures in place for business continuity and disaster recovery processes and procedures Maintenance of video conference and telephony operations


3. Team Management
  • Facilitates the engagement and provision of high quality results and services of the team supervised through effective work planning, performance management, coaching, and promotion of learning and development.

  • Provides oversight, ensuring compliance by team members with existing policies and best practices.

4. Knowledge building and knowledge sharing
  • Training  and guidance to users in efficient and secure use of ICT systems and services

  • Advice to management, clients and colleagues on subject matter expertise

  • Synthesis and dissemination of best practices to internal collaborators and networks


Education/Experience/Language requirements

A. Education
  • Completion of Secondary education is required.

  • University Degree, preferably in information sciences, computer sciences or engineering, is  desirable and can substitute for some years of experience.

B. Work experience
  • A minimum of 7 years of progressively responsible experience in the field of information technology and/or telecommunications and systems, preferably in an international environment is required.

  • Experience in the usage of computers and office software packages (e.g. Google Suite) is required.

  • Experience in management of Active Directory, Windows servers, and network infrastructure is desirable.

C. Language Requirements
  • Fluency in English and Ukrainian is required.
